MySQL按月份区间查询实现方法
简介
在MySQL中,按月份区间查询是一项常见的任务。它允许我们根据日期字段来查询指定月份范围内的数据。本文将以表格形式展示整个实现过程,并提供每个步骤所需的代码和注释。
实现步骤
下面是实现MySQL按月份区间查询的步骤:
步骤 | 描述 |
---|---|
1 | 创建表格和数据 |
2 | 构建查询语句 |
3 | 执行查询语句 |
4 | 查看结果 |
接下来,我们将详细说明每个步骤需要做的事情以及提供相应的代码。
步骤1:创建表格和数据
在这一步中,我们将创建一个包含日期字段的表,并插入一些示例数据。
-- 创建表
CREATE TABLE records (
id INT AUTO_INCREMENT PRIMARY KEY,
value INT,
date DATE
);
-- 插入数据
INSERT INTO records (value, date) VALUES
(100, '2022-01-01'),
(200, '2022-02-15'),
(300, '2022-03-10'),
(400, '2022-04-20'),
(500, '2022-05-05');
以上代码创建了一个名为records
的表格,并插入了一些示例数据,每条数据包含了一个日期字段。
步骤2:构建查询语句
在这一步中,我们需要构建一个查询语句,以便按月份区间来检索数据。
-- 构建查询语句
SELECT * FROM records
WHERE date >= '2022-02-01' AND date <= '2022-04-30';
以上代码中的查询语句使用了WHERE
子句来筛选出处于指定月份区间内的数据。在这个例子中,我们查询了2月至4月之间的数据。
步骤3:执行查询语句
在这一步中,我们需要执行之前构建的查询语句。
-- 执行查询语句
将以上代码复制到MySQL客户端中,并执行查询语句。
步骤4:查看结果
在这一步中,我们需要查看查询结果,以确认是否按照预期进行了按月份区间的查询。
-- 查看结果
执行查询语句后,你将获得一个包含符合指定月份区间的数据的结果集。
结论
本文介绍了MySQL按月份区间查询的实现方法,并提供了每个步骤所需的代码和注释。通过按照这些步骤进行操作,你可以轻松地实现按月份区间来查询MySQL数据。